MRT3 Circle Line

The MRT3 Circle Line is the critical final piece to complete Kuala Lumpur’s urban rail network. Its 50.8km alignment will run along the perimeter of the city of Kuala Lumpur. Once completed, the transit network will further encourage public transport usage in Kuala Lumpur.

MRT Putrajaya Line

The Putrajaya Line is the second line of the Klang Valley MRT network. The 57.7km line stretches from Kwasa Damansara, a new township being developed  in northwest Kuala Lumpur, through the city centre, to Putrajaya, Malaysia’s federal administrative centre.

RTS Link
between Johor
and Singapore

The RTS Link is a modern light rail transit system linking two stations – Bukit Chagar in Johor Bahru, Malaysia and Woodlands North in Singapore. The 4km rail shuttle service will provide a fast and efficient cross border transport mode between the two countries.

MRT Kajang Line

The 46km MRT Kajang Line is the first line of the Klang Valley MRT Project to be built. The entire line began operations on 17 July 2017 and runs from Sungai Buloh, through the city center of Kuala Lumpur, before ending in Kajang.
